Ads Yanked From Penn State Games | NBC Philadelphia

Cars.com, a website visited by more than 10 million people every month, made the decision to pull its advertisements from airing during Penn State games, in the wake of the recent sex abuse scandal

A Pennsylvania company recently made headlines over their decision to distance themselves from the Penn State scandal. Meadows Racetrack and Casino, located 30 minutes south of Pittsburgh, put Hall of Fame running back Franco Harris on hiatus after he vocally defended Joe Paterno.

"Penn State will likely be a risky investment for major corporations for a while to come, as the story's not over and will probably be kept alive with years of litigation," President of Makovsky & Co. Kenneth D. Makovsky told the Philadelphia Inquirer.
